FSU baseball proactively commits to new terms with Link Jarrett amid Tennessee opening

On Monday, Florida State Athletic Director Michael Alford faced scrutiny from FSU fans after issuing a statement supporting FSU football coach Mike Norvell through the end of the season.

Thursday, FSU announced that Michael Alford and FSU baseball head coach Link Jarrett had come to an agreement on new contract terms for Jarrett.

Jarrett originally signed a seven-year deal in 2022 when he came to FSU from Notre Dame. He signed a contract extension after the 2024 season with FSU, reaching the College World Series and amassing 49 wins.

However, FSU is being proactive with Tennessee head coach Tony Vitello taking the San Francisco Giants manager position.
